Transaction e3432c39446e494bc1a4ce7fc34511fd8a35eba3ba3958bc16d62051fd2b9cd4

1 Input
2 Outputs
  • e3432c39446e494bc1a4ce7fc34511fd8a35eba3ba3958bc16d62051fd2b9cd4:0
  • value  576051
    address  1F4QynRwvdu4mHaXqvQbbcRKSuZW7RSQHL
  • e3432c39446e494bc1a4ce7fc34511fd8a35eba3ba3958bc16d62051fd2b9cd4:1
  • value  28423041
    address  34wjD7Te6ZeVm6nHRh5d99DiRMcE3hmiUu